0

我正在尝试创建一个 jquery 脚本来将每个 div 旋转 15 * x 度,但它不会工作。我从 w3schools 中找到了 css 旋转代码,实际上确实是从样式表中工作的。

无论如何,我正在使用的代码:

$(function() {
    var nrOfDivs = $(this).length();
    for(x=0; x=nrOfDivs; x++) {
        var y = x * 15;
        var wheelSpin = {
            'transform' : 'rotate(' + y + ')',
            '-ms-transform' : 'rotate(' + y + ')',
            '-moz-transform' : 'rotate(' + y + ')',
            '-webkit-transform' : 'rotate(' + y + ')',
            '-o-transform' : 'rotate(' + y + ')' 
        }
        $('.wheelbox').each(function() {
            $(this).css(wheelSpin);
        });
    }
}); 

我在 jquery 中做错了什么?

4

1 回答 1

0

你的循环是错误的

 for(x=0; x=nrOfDivs; x++)


它应该是x < nrOfDivs或者无论布尔值是否合适。

肯定x=nrOfDivs不好

于 2013-03-17T20:44:41.570 回答